#61853e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#61853e is composed of 38% red, 52.2%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.4%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 90.4 degrees, a saturation of 36.4% and a lightness of 38.2%. #61853e color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ff7c with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

Shades and Tints of #61853e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090d06 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#61853e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#61675c is the less saturated color, while #60c102 is the most saturated one.
